SAXBY'S ORIGINAL CIDER IS NOW AVAILABLE IN 5L MINI KEGS

A new product for all you sparkling cider fans to take home to share! Our 5 litre mini keg which is now available in Original 5.0% cider with Rhubarb 3.5% cider coming soon.

Our mini kegs are recyclable as they are made of tin plated steel which is the same as used for baked bean cans. Once opened drink within 4 days and close the bung on the top between pours to keep the sparkle.

On sale at our shop at Chester House Estate and on the farm and online … now to plan that party!

Saxby's Apple Cider Vinegar is here!

Saxby’s Apple Cider Vinegar is pure, raw cider vinegar with the Mother. We do not filter or pasteurise which means it is bursting with beneficial bacteria and helpful enzymes. Enjoy on salads, in sauces or on it’s own as a great help to your body’s natural immune system. Cider Vinegar is made and bottled on our farm - nice and simple just like life should be. There maybe some sediment in the bottle this is perfectly natural simply shake the bottle and enjoy. Don't be put off by the sour taste. There are many enjoyable ways to take your recommended 50ml of ACV every day. Try adding two tablespoons to a glass of water and add honey to sweeten to your preferred taste. Be creative and we'd love to hear how you take yours!

SPECIAL LIMITED EDITION BURNING BARN CIDER BARREL FINISHED APPLE RUM MADE USING SAXBY'S APPLE JUICE NOW LAUNCHED

Order early! A Limited Edition collaboration with Burning Barn Rum. Based on a Normandy style Pommeau, 3-year aged dark rum blended with cider apple juice and a little honey, then finished in oak cider barrels to create a 40.5% Cider Barrel Finished Apple Rum.

The bottles are available to buy in our shop on the farm in Farndish and at our Chester House Estate shop.

10% of the profits from this bottle will go to The Youth Sports Trust via the amazing Paddy’s Project 52.

On the nose; heady apple aroma, fresh soft fruit; strawberries, bramble. Cider and a hint of oak coming through later.

To taste; huge buttery cream notes to start, sweet, stewed apple and dried fruits; Port or Madeira like. Dark peppery rum in the background. Treacle tart. Everything elevated by slight acidity and complex aromatic sweetness of English Apples.

70cl bottle

40.5% ABV
